Dempsey Sharp

Dempsey Lee Sharp, age 59, of Buckeye, passed away Wednesday, December 14, 2016, at Pocahontas Memorial Hospital in Buckeye, following a heart attack.

Born November 26, 1957, in Marlinton, he was a son of the late Norman Samuel and Beulah June Sharp.

Dempsey was a retired Union coal miner, known to coworkers as “Sparky.” He worked for Ranger-Fuel, Massey, PJ&H Kerstan, Peabody and Bear Run Mines. He loved being outdoors, especially fishing and hunting.

He loved spending time with his grandchildren, family and friends.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by two brothers, Ricky L. Sharp and Norman Sharp, Jr.

He is survived by two daughters, Crystal L. Moore, and husband, Jackie L. of Lewisburg, and Jessica C. Sharp, and husband, Stanley D. Friel, of Marlinton; his wife (companion), Barbara Lynn Sharp, of Buckeye; two grandsons, Brandon (Bubby) Friel and Shameron Friel, both of Marlinton; a granddaughter, Lillie Moore, of Lewisburg; a brother, David W. Sharp, of Marlinton; two sisters, Rachel V. Sharp, of Buckeye, and Martha Sharp, of Beckley; many nieces and nephews; and several great friends.

Per his wishes, the body was cremated.

A memorial service will be held Friday, December 30, 4 p.m. at VanReenen Funeral Home. Family will receive friends two hours prior to the service.
